What is a monograph?
Answer:
Monograph is a specialist work of writing or information on a particular taxon i. e., family or genus or on aspect of subject usually for a single author. Main purpose of monograph is to present primary research and original work and thus is non - serial publication, complete in one book (volume) of a finite number of volumes.
